Personally, I enjoy MMOs, and have no issue paying $15 a month. In that given month, I can easily get over 100 hours time in if I really wanted to. The majority of games people spend $60 on only have about 20hours of gameplay, and that is being very generous. That alone is more than enough reason in my opinion to play. And really, when compared to going to the movies (which is $10 for a ticket then whatev u buy) isn't that bad at all.

If someone doesn't like that gameplay, then fine.... but if the only thing holding you back is the monthly fee, take what I said into consideration. I'm crossing my fingers and hoping that this will be a great MMO.
